Moss Rose thrives in full sun in dry to moderately moist, weak to typical, properly-drained soils. It may possibly tolerate some afternoon shade in incredibly hot summer climates and is drought tolerant as soon as set up but performs very best with typical food stuff and water.

Fertilizer Moss rose plants commonly don’t require fertilizer to prosper, however you can increase a time-release well balanced fertilizer when you plant moss rose.
